Philip Morris International Shifts Entire Capacity of Its Cigarette Factory in Greece to Smoke-Free Products
March 21 2018 - 8:31AM
Business Wire
- Another step towards its vision to
provide all men and women who smoke with better alternatives
Philip Morris International Inc. (PMI) (NYSE: PM) announced
today that the factory of its Greek affiliate (Papastratos) in
Aspropyrgos, has ceased cigarette production and is now exclusively
producing HEETS, the tobacco units used with IQOS, the company’s
most advanced smoke-free product. This first full conversion of a
cigarette factory is a landmark step in our vision of a smoke-free
future where people who smoke switch from the most harmful form of
nicotine consumption – cigarettes – to scientifically substantiated
smoke-free alternatives.
The EUR 300 million investment included the construction of
three new buildings and the replacement of cigarette production
lines with high-tech facilities capable of producing 10,000
smoke-free tobacco units per minute. The conversion of the factory
started in August 2017. The facility is expected to be fully
operational by the end of 2018 and will create 400 new jobs.

Along with our plant near Bologna, Italy, Papastratos is our
company’s second facility fully dedicated to manufacturing
smoke-free products. We have also announced plans to either fully
or partially transform our cigarette factories in Korea, Romania
and Russia.
Since 2008, we have invested more than USD 4.5 billion in
scientific research, product and commercial development, and
production capacity related to IQOS and other smoke-free products.
In 2017, over 70% of our global R&D expenditure and over 30% of
our global commercial expenditure was allocated to smoke-free
products.
We estimate that at the end of January 2018, nearly 5 million
adult consumers around the world have already stopped smoking and
